ANNIE PENNER

Annie Penner di ed Feb . 4. She was born Sept. 1, 1915 in Main Centre, Sask. to Jo- hann and Justina ~Wl~" Siemens . They moved to Yarrow, B.C in 1939. She attended Elim Bible School. She married Frank Sawatsky in 1946. They attended Arnold (B.C) MB Church. He died in a car accident in 1952. She married Corny Penner. He died in 1962. She sold the farm and moved to Abbot- ford, where she worked as a homemaker and as a cook at Columbia Bible College. She demonstrated love for her family and was dedicated to good deeds . She had a zest for living, was generous to and con- cerned for others. She doted on her grandchildren, painted, practiced reflexol- ogy and volunteered at MCC. She made more than 1000 blankets for MCC. Prede- ceased by Frank and Corny, she is mourned by sons Len, Les and Frank; 8 grandchildren; 7 great-grandchildren; 2 brothers; stepchildren Lilly Bowering, Mar- garet Barron and Martha Bergen; 5 step- grandchildren; 4 step-great-grandchil- dren. The funeral was Feb . 9 in Clearbrook MB Church.
